How they compare

Saint Lucia currently reports 10,316 current US$ against 8,954 current US$ in Poland, a difference of 1,362 current US$.

That makes Saint Lucia's figure about 1.2 times Poland's.

The two have swapped places 5 times across 26 shared years of data; in 1995 it was Poland ahead.

Poland ranks 53rd and Saint Lucia ranks 50th of 150 countries.

Across the 4 decades both report, Poland averaged higher in 1 and Saint Lucia in 3.
